Price tags can be misleading in Delta Force. A small object with a high sale value might look like the answer to your next loadout, but you'll often regret turning it into cash too soon. Some Delta Force Items are tied to missions, workshop progress, or upgrades that don't become relevant until several raids later. You may clear space today, then spend the next week checking drawers, crates, and enemy packs for the exact thing you sold. That's the annoying part: the item felt replaceable when it was sitting in your stash. Once a task asks for it, it suddenly feels rare again. Treat unfamiliar valuables with a bit of suspicion, especially during your early progression when new requirements keep appearing.

Look at your active tasks first

Before selling anything marked as rare, open your mission screen and read the requirements properly. Don't just check the task you're currently tracking. Have a look at nearby mission chains too, since one completed objective can open another that asks for materials you had no reason to notice before. A decent habit is keeping a small corner of your storage for task-related finds. It doesn't need to be perfectly organised. Just put questionable items there rather than mixing them into your regular sale pile. When you come back from a rough raid with a full bag, that separation saves time. More importantly, it stops those accidental sales made while you're rushing to buy ammo or patch up damaged gear.

Think beyond the market value

An item's sale price is only one part of its value. Crafting materials, upgrade components, electronics, and specialised supplies can remove a lot of future grind if you hold onto them at the right time. The same idea applies to items with more than one use. Something needed for both a mission and a facility upgrade deserves a storage slot, even if it seems expensive enough to sell. You'll quickly notice that keeping a few key materials makes your progress feel steadier. Instead of stopping every few raids to hunt one missing part, you can actually use the resources you've collected.

Sell duplicates, not your safety net

There's no point hoarding ten copies of every unusual item. Storage fills up fast, and a cluttered stash makes it harder to spot what matters. Keep one copy when you're unsure, or two if it's used often and difficult to find. After the related task is done and your upgrades no longer need it, the extra copies become much easier to move. This gives you money without leaving your account empty-handed. Common valuables should usually go first when funds are low. They're easier to replace, and selling them won't derail your next objective. It also helps to keep enough cash for the basics: a workable weapon, protection, healing supplies, ammunition, and the little purchases that add up before each raid.

Give every item a place

A simple routine beats trying to memorise every piece of loot. Put mission items in one area, useful upgrade parts in another, and ordinary sellables somewhere separate. Anything you can't identify right away can sit in a short-term review section until you've checked its description or looked at your upcoming tasks. Do this after each raid, not only when your storage is packed. It takes a minute, and it prevents the usual panic sale when you need room for one more backpack. Good storage management isn't about keeping everything forever. It's about holding the pieces that protect your progress, then selling the rest when they've genuinely stopped being useful.
